Transaction 77c12c4409a5410c1f0f88b324603aefab710f3ab6128aca1cd388023c3d5df6

24 Input
2 Outputs
  • 77c12c4409a5410c1f0f88b324603aefab710f3ab6128aca1cd388023c3d5df6:0
  • value  647711189
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 77c12c4409a5410c1f0f88b324603aefab710f3ab6128aca1cd388023c3d5df6:1
  • value  979638
    address  3ELn1zmrL9aw1zsLXJyvgZTpBpSvu3YcYf